Superintendent Position Overview The Superintendent oversees and directs the performance of all field construction activities for assigned crews regarding plans, specifications, schedules, and cost estimates. Responsibilities: Prepare and submit a three-week look-ahead schedule by end of day Thursday each week. Attend weekly scheduling meetings with updated and accurate project information. Collaborate effectively with Project Managers to monitor and manage project budgets throughout the project duration. Schedule subcontractors with adequate advance notice to ensure smooth workflow. Maintain and update project schedules weekly, notifying Project Managers and General Superintendents of any deviations from the original plan. Coordinate with the Concrete Division to confirm job readiness. Develop and maintain a master schedule for each project. Approve all employee time entries by 5:00 PM each Monday (mandatory). Participate in the recruitment, interviewing, and hiring of crew members as needed. Ensure full compliance with OSHA and Moss safety policies and procedures; exercise Stop Work Authority when necessary. Respond promptly to all phone calls—within minutes, not hours. If unavailable, send a text message to acknowledge receipt. Review project plans with the Foreman to verify accuracy, material needs, and subcontractor coordination. Schedule equipment, fuel, and tools with a minimum of 72 hours’ notice. Review all safety documentation and ensure implementation of best safety practices on site. Hold Foremen accountable for their job duties and adherence to safety standards. Monitor work quality, materials on site, and identify potential schedule conflicts proactively. Build and maintain positive relationships with Inspectors and General Contractors through consistent daily communication. Verify that BaseCamp is updated in accordance with the outline provided by the VP of Field Operations. Ensure that Operators complete equipment inspection reports accurately by reviewing both the reports and the physical machines for verification.
